The game engine that powered some of the most critically acclaim and fun games of its era, with games like:

  • Half Life
  • Half Life: Opposing Force
  • Half Life Blue Shift
  • Team Fortress Classic
  • Counterstrike
  • Day Of Defeat
  • and many more.

A powerful engine for it's time, it helped propel modding forward quite a bit with its mod development tools, even though it's already almost 10 years old, it's mod projects are still going strong.

On-and-off Team Member and friend "Rayne" has recently been kind enough to make the Linux .so server file for the current version of RE:CB!

This means that those running their PC or server under Linux can now host servers. You will not be able to play the mod yet if you are running Linux.

Thanks again, Rayne.

Click here to download RE:CB Linux Binary

How to install:

Very simple. Simply extract and overwrite your ./&#xhl;ds_install_dir%/recbb2/liblist.gam file with the one provided in the .rar, and then extract the recb_i386.so to your ./&#xhl;ds_install_dir%/recbb2/dlls folder. Done!
